Where’s the outrage?

That’s what Edward Watson wanted to know when he disrupted Mayor Lovely Warren during a morning news conference Thursday at the scene of the Boys & Girls Club of Rochester mass shooting that left three people dead and four wounded.

Last week, a man was shot to death in broad daylight outside a community center, and between then and the mass shooting, six other people were shot on city streets in low-profile incidents that have become so routine they hardly make news anymore.

Where’s the outrage? Where are the demonstrations? Where are the politicians screaming from the steps of City Hall?

“If this was a white police officer gunning down three blacks and injuring four, Wilson High School would be on fire and every black leader, every community leader would be up here,” Watson yelled. “Blacks are murdering blacks every 32 hours since June!”

Watson, a 56-year-old black, lifelong resident of Rochester, was referring to statistics cited in this column on Sunday, which noted that shootings have escalated to the point that someone has been shot on average every 32 hours this summer.

The column noted that most of the shootings stem from disputes between victims and perpetrators with criminal histories, but didn’t reference the ethnicity of the combatants because the Rochester Police Department could not immediately provide hard data in that area.

The department did confirm, however, what’s obvious to anyone who follows local crime — including Watson — that shooting victims and suspects are typically young, black men.

“Because it‘s black-on-black crime, it is socially acceptable for blacks to not talk to the police, and it’s appalling!” yelled Watson, who demanded that City Hall “do a better job.”

In response, Warren noted that she was at the scene and reiterated earlier remarks that, “The outrage is there.”

Most people, including the news media, often only see local leaders address street violence in times of collective tragedy.

But Warren said her commitment is round-the-clock. She said she visits families touched by gun violence all the time and addresses the topic at community and church meetings that reporters don’t cover.

Hours before the mass shooting, Warren said, she attended a gathering in a northeast Rochester park to pray for an end to the street violence. On Thursday, she said, she consoled a City Hall intern whose relative was hurt at the Boys & Girls Club.

Later in the day, she delivered an impassioned speech at the Rochester Police Department in which she used words like “angry” and “outraged” and “devastated” to describe her own feelings, and challenged city residents to take a morality check.

“Unfortunately, we can’t legislate morality,” she said. “The violence needs to stop here and now.

“I assure you,” she continued, “that I will not let this moment pass. You should not let this moment pass. We must turn this moment into the moment when Rochester said, ‘We deserve better.’ ”

There have been grass roots attempts to tackle gun and gang violence in inner cities - there was a big campaign going in Newark when I lived near there.

The problem is that in many of these places, there are a whole host of social problems and some of these communities lack leadership, money or access to local authority support.

Its the reason why a white man getting gunned down outside a Starbucks will get more coverage than half a dozen black youths getting shot to pieces in a gang shooting. There's an assumption that this is a state of normal in some parts of the country - and other people (forum posters for exanple) look at it 'outside in' - which is why attempts to have a reasonable dialogue always get mired in racism.
